Memorial Dinner for Garry Bellefleur Is Set For June 5th
Supper to Be Held in His Hometown of Stetson, Maine


By Mike Twist

A charity event for the late PASS North driver Gary Bellefleur has been scheduled for June 5th in his hometown of Stetson, Maine. The Gary Bellefleur Memorial Supper will benefit a memorial fund to assist his family and honor his memory. The dinner will take place on Saturday, June 5th from 4-7pm at the Stetson Union Church. Donations will be accepted at the door.

The supper will feature hot dogs and beans along with cole slaw provided by Maine racing legend Ralph Nason. Deserts will also be a part of the fare. It is being organized by PASS North driver and team owner Scott Mulkern with the help of PASS North driver Gary Smith and PASS Sportsman driver Duane Seekins.

Bellefleur passed away late last month after a shop accident while he was preparing his racecar for the 2010 PASS North season. He had strong ties to the Stetson community, where he served as a Town Selectman and previously headed the Sebasticook Valley Chamber of Commerce. He is survived by his wife Melodie, son Gary and daughter Cassie.
